**Description:**
**Reporting to the Supervisor, Phlebotomy, Lab, Phlebotomy, this position is responsible for the procurement of blood specimens via venipuncture or skin puncture technique, preparation of specimens for testing, and processing and accessioning of specimens.**
**1. High school diploma or equivalent is required.**
**2. Valid Phlebotomy certification with the State of California Department of Health Services is required.**
**3. Current American Heart Association (AHA) Healthcare Provider CPR card is required.**
**4. Minimum one year of phlebotomy experience in an acute care setting is preferred.**
**5. Excellent venipuncture and effective communication skills are required.**
**Pay Range: $22.00 - $30.91**
